This special set of 6 stamps in a miniature sheet format commemorates the 200th anniversary of the first journey on rails by a steam locomotive in February 1804. The inventor and engineer responsible for this achievement was Richard Trevithick. This classic issue features a variety of different types of locomotive travelling on preserved railways around the UK, with the thrill and energy of the steam further enhanced by the 60 x 12mm format. The designers Harold Batten and Mike Denny, chose their subjects to represent a range of locomotive types, ages and railway companies and photographer John Wildgoose travelled the UK to capture the locomotives in their full glory.
